Transaction ec8ffc45e707971079e65b44111f58fa150ee47111308cc93d764ddaf51a6c33

1 Input
2 Outputs
  • ec8ffc45e707971079e65b44111f58fa150ee47111308cc93d764ddaf51a6c33:0
  • value  14326
    address  1NX2M5Tsv8jgrozCBYnL1SLdjtDQu8RWGk
  • ec8ffc45e707971079e65b44111f58fa150ee47111308cc93d764ddaf51a6c33:1
  • value  28898037
    address  3LguMyojocArdSbnNHcscjQogxR1ZSCqak